UN General Assembly AI Governance Resolution (August 2025)
enactedInternationalUN General Assembly resolution adopted August 26, 2025 establishing two new AI governance bodies. US explicitly rejected "centralized control and global governance" of AI at UN Security Council. China supported framework, aligned with developing countries.
